Congratulations Interns!
This past week marked the end of our interns 6-week time at Hanaeleh. They worked on grooming, leading, longeing, saddling, etc. as well as learning about conformation, medical info, etc. We ended the internship with a small sensory clinic, with the horses and interns working with various different obstacles. Happy Birthday Cricket! (and Quixote!)
Last year today, we picked up Cricket and Quixote from a nearby stable who was going to send the horses to auction to pay for the unpaid board fees. They were both emaciated, had little muscle tone, and were so bonded that it was dangerous to pull either one out of the stall because they would both freak out.
